Standard treatments and modern antibiotics prove ineffective against the antibiotic-resistant strain. Facing a growing death toll, Max proposes a risky solution using , a drug from the 1950s that was pulled from the market because it causes severe kidney failure. To save the patients, the team decides to administer the drug while simultaneously placing every patient on dialysis to mitigate the damage.
